web前端开发有哪些好的书籍推荐
-
在web前端开发领域,有许多优秀的书籍可以供参考和学习。以下是一些比较受欢迎和推荐的书籍:
1.《JavaScript权威指南》- 由Douglas Crockford撰写的这本书是学习JavaScript的经典指南。它详细讲解了JavaScript的语法、对象模型以及高级技巧等内容,是一本非常全面且权威的参考书。
2.《CSS权威指南》- Eric A. Meyer和Estelle Weyl合著的这本书是学习CSS的权威指南。它详细介绍了CSS的各种属性和选择器,以及常见的布局和响应式设计等技术,是一本非常实用的书籍。
3.《HTML5权威指南》- 由Ian Hickson和他的团队编写的这本书是学习HTML5的权威指南。它深入探讨了HTML5的各种新特性和API,如canvas、地理位置和多媒体等,是一本必读的书籍。
4.《高性能网站建设指南》- Steve Souders撰写的这本书介绍了许多提高网站性能的技巧和优化策略。它涵盖了前端优化的各个方面,如文件合并、压缩、缓存和异步加载等,对于提升网站性能非常有帮助。
5.《前端开发工具与工作流》- 作者Dylan Schiemann、Yehuda Katz、Rebecca Murphey和Bryan Sullivan讲述了如何使用现代化的开发工具和工作流程来提高前端开发效率。书中涵盖了各种工具和技术,如Git、Grunt、Webpack和单元测试等,适合那些希望提高开发效率的前端开发者阅读。
当然,除了上述书籍之外,还有许多其他优秀的前端开发书籍,如《JavaScript高级程序设计》、《响应式Web设计》、《Node.js实战》等。对于不同的学习阶段和需求,可以选择适合自己的书籍来学习和参考。
1年前 -
-
《HTML与CSS设计与构建网站》 – 该书是Web前端开发的入门教材,详细介绍了HTML和CSS的基本知识和技巧,适合初学者学习和掌握前端开发的基础。
-
《JavaScript高级程序设计》 – 这本书是学习JavaScript必备的经典教材,从基础语法到高级应用都有详细的讲解,同时也介绍了最新的Web开发技术和规范。
-
《JavaScript权威指南》 – 这是一本完整而详细的JavaScript参考手册,对JavaScript语法、函数、对象等方面进行了系统地讲解,是进阶学习JavaScript的不二之选。
-
《CSS Secrets》 – 这本书主要讲解了一些CSS的高级技巧和实用的技术,适合对CSS有一定基础的开发者进一步提高自己的CSS技能。
-
《前端工程化体系设计与实践》 – 这本书介绍了前端工程化的概念和实践方法,包括版本控制、构建工具、自动化测试等方面,帮助开发者提高前端项目的效率和质量。
-
《CSS揭秘》 – 这本书主要介绍了一些CSS的技巧和解决方案,通过深入的了解CSS的各种属性和特性,帮助开发者更好地应对实际项目中的前端开发需求。
-
《Web性能权威指南》 – 这本书详细介绍了Web性能优化的各个方面,包括网络请求、页面渲染、资源优化等,帮助开发者提升网站的性能和用户体验。
-
《响应式Web设计》 – 这本书主要讲解了响应式Web设计的原理和实践方法,帮助开发者设计和开发出适应不同设备和屏幕尺寸的网站。
这些书籍覆盖了Web前端开发的基本知识、高级技巧、工程化实践以及性能优化等方面,适合不同层次的前端开发者阅读和学习。
1年前 -
-
推荐以下几本经典的Web前端开发书籍:
-
《JavaScript高级程序设计》(JavaScript: The Good Parts)
- 作者:Douglas Crockford
- 特点:介绍了JavaScript的核心概念和高级特性,深入讲解了闭包、原型链等重要概念,对于理解JavaScript的设计思想和用法非常有帮助。
-
《HTML与CSS设计与构建网站》(HTML and CSS: Design and Build Websites)
- 作者:Jon Duckett
- 特点:全面介绍了HTML和CSS的基础知识和实践技巧,适合初学者系统学习,书中内容结构清晰,配有大量示例和漂亮的设计风格。
-
《CSS权威指南》(CSS: The Definitive Guide)
- 作者:Eric A. Meyer、Estelle Weyl
- 特点:详细介绍了CSS的各种属性和特性,适合对CSS有一定了解的开发者深入学习和查阅,书中内容全面、准确,有助于提升CSS的使用水平。
-
《JavaScript设计模式》(Learning JavaScript Design Patterns)
- 作者:Addy Osmani
- 特点:讲解了常用的JavaScript设计模式,如单例模式、观察者模式等,通过案例和实践帮助开发者理解和运用设计模式,提高代码质量和可维护性。
-
《响应式Web设计》(Responsive Web Design)
- 作者:Ethan Marcotte
- 特点:介绍了响应式Web设计的原理和实践,帮助开发者构建适应不同设备和屏幕尺寸的网站,书中提供了丰富的案例和技术示例。
-
《高性能网站建设指南》(High Performance Web Sites)
- 作者:Steve Souders
- 特点:讲解了提高网站性能的一些优化技巧和实践方法,包括优化页面加载速度、减少HTTP请求等方面的内容,对于提高前端开发效率和用户体验有很大帮助。
这些书籍涵盖了Web前端开发的基础知识、核心技术、实践经验和性能优化等方面的内容,可以帮助开发者全面提升自己的前端开发能力。当然,除了这些书籍外,还有很多其他优秀的前端开发书籍,可以根据自己的需要和兴趣选择适合的来阅读。
1年前 -